Handover note — Crumbwheel order cutoffs.

Welcome aboard. The bakery cutoff rule in Crumbwheel closes same-day orders at 14:00 local to each storefront, not UTC — this has bitten us twice. Holiday overrides live in the calendar service and take precedence silently, so always check there first when a cutoff looks wrong. To unlock the calendar service's admin console after a restart, enter the recovery passphrase below.

vault phrase of bagap-bahaf = silion-pelox-sorox-casdor-quenwyn-fraax-eliox-praael-kelion-quenvan-kasox-rusael-norius-belvan

## Authentication

The Crumbwell cutoff service enforces the bakery's order-cutoff rule: orders placed after 14:00 local time roll to the next production day. Support staff checking why an order rolled over can query the cutoff API directly rather than guessing from timestamps, since the service accounts for holidays and early-close days. All requests must be authenticated; unauthenticated calls return an empty schedule rather than an error. Support tooling should authenticate to the internal cutoff service with the key below.

service key, kawip-kahop: kto4_QQzB

Welcome to the PedalShift team! If the rebalancing dashboard locks you out (happens more than we'd like), hit the account recovery link and pick the ops profile. You'll get asked for the team recovery passphrase before it resets anything — don't guess, it locks after three tries. The passphrase you'll need is:

vault phrase of tajef-tafog = istox-sorax-zorox-casok-holox-kelix-weneth-drueth-casion

Subject: Waveform preview cut-over complete

Team,

The cut-over of the audio waveform preview from Soundline-legacy to the new Crestpath renderer finished at 03:40 local time. All preview generation now goes through Crestpath; the legacy queue is drained and disabled. Expect slightly different peak rendering on short clips — that's intended. If error rates on preview jobs climb above 2%, roll back via the standard toggle and page the media team. For reference during your shift, the active configuration values are listed below.

deployment values, taduf-fawig:
WENAEL_HOST=wenael.zemvarlabs.internal
WENAEL_PORT=8443